## What Was Built
### 1. Dockerfile (`labs/lab-01-iam/Dockerfile`)
Created a 61-line Dockerfile that implements non-root container execution:
- **Base Image:** Alpine 3.19 (minimal, secure)
- **User Creation:** Creates `labuser` with UID/GID 1000 using `addgroup` and `adduser`
- **USER Directive:** Switches to non-root user BEFORE any operations
- **Verification:** CMD demonstrates non-root execution with `whoami`, `id`, and other checks
- **Labels:** Metadata for documentation and traceability
- **Test File:** Creates and verifies write permissions in user's home directory
Key implementation follows INF-01 requirement strictly - no process runs as root.
### 2. Docker Compose Configuration (`labs/lab-01-iam/docker-compose.yml`)
Created a 37-line docker-compose.yml that enforces non-root execution:
- **Service Definition:** `lab01-test` builds from local Dockerfile
- **User Directive:** `user: "1000:1000"` enforces non-root execution
- **Container Name:** `lab01-iam-test` for easy reference in tests
- **Healthcheck:** Verifies non-root user with `whoami | grep -q labuser`
- **No Ports Exposed:** Security best practice - not needed for this lab
- **Comments:** Explains why no volumes/networks (future labs)
Follows Docker Compose V3.8 syntax and INF-01 compliance requirements.

## Technical Implementation Details
### Non-Root Container Pattern
The implementation follows Docker security best practices:
```dockerfile
# Create non-root user
RUN addgroup -g 1000 labuser && \
adduser -D -u 1000 -G labuser labuser
# Switch BEFORE any operations
USER labuser
# Verify in CMD
CMD ["sh", "-c", "whoami && ..."]
```
### User Directive Enforcement
Docker Compose enforces non-root execution at runtime:
```yaml
services:
lab01-test:
user: "1000:1000" # UID:GID
```
This defense-in-depth approach ensures:
1. Dockerfile switches to non-root user
2. docker-compose.yml enforces it at runtime
3. Healthcheck verifies continuously
4. Tests validate automatically
### Fixed Issues During Implementation
1. **Docker Compose V2 Command:** Updated `docker-compose` to `docker compose` (hyphen removed in V2)
2. **Bash Arithmetic with `set -e`:** Used helper functions `inc_pass()` and `inc_fail()` with `|| true` to handle counter increments
3. **Docker Build Context:** Fixed build command to use `-q .` instead of `-q Dockerfile`
